本篇文章给大家谈谈vue清空inputfile的值,以及vue $ref内容清空对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、Vue中实现输入框Input输入限制
- 2、vue如何获取input的值(vue如何获取input里面的值)
- 3、vue如何获取input的值
- 4、vue3在@input 上手动改变input的值,但是视图上的值改了
- 5、el-input默认设置在哪
- 6、vue切换input的type类型,为什么输入框中的内容也会被清空
Vue中实现输入框Input输入限制
在Vue中实现输入框Input输入限制,可以通过以下几种 *** :利用Vue的修饰符:.number修饰符:可以通过在vmodel后添加.number来实现数字输入限制。但请注意,这种 *** 仅适用于简单的数字输入,存在局限性。监听@input :通过监听@input ,可以实时获取输入框的内容并进行处理,以实现更复杂的输入限制。
之一种 *** 是利用Vue的修饰符实现数字输入限制,通过在`v-model`后添加`.number`。然而,这种 *** 存在局限性。第二种 *** 是通过监听`@input` ,实时更新数据,以实现数字输入。此 *** 较为灵活,能自定义限制输入内容,但需注意,不适用于批量场景。为解决批量限制需求,可封装全局指令。
在Vue开发直播商城时,为了确保input输入框只接受数字输入,可以利用内置的特性。当你在v-model指令中添加`number`修饰符,Vue会自动将用户的文本输入转换为数字格式。这在处理数值输入时非常实用,特别是当input类型设置为`number`时,Vue会进行自动转换,无需额外添加修饰符。
首先,如果需要限制输入为数字、英文,可以使用正则表达式来实现。可以通过在input元素上添加 ,利用`@input` *** 来验证输入内容。其次,如果需要限制输入为正整数,可以将输入值转换为数字并进行判断。如果输入的值为负数或非整数,可以使用`v-model`指令将输入值更新为一个 的正整数。
该指令旨在解决Vue框架中仅允许输入正整数或浮点数的限制问题。通常,限制input仅能输入特定字符,我们会通过监听其input 并使用正则表达式过滤非法字符。然而,Vue的v-model特性,实际上结合了v-bind和v-on,意味着其更新基于input 监听。因此,直接修改input的value并不会同步到v-model。
vue如何获取input的值(vue如何获取input里面的值)
首先,在页面中引入Vue框架。接着,定义Vue应用的基本结构,包含数据和行为。在定义中,加入一个输入框元素,用于用户输入信息,同时定义一个变量来存储这个输入框的值。为了将输入框的值与变量进行关联,使用v-model指令,将输入框绑定到这个变量上。
实现点击按钮复制input输入框内容,可以借助clipboard.js库。首先,通过npm安装此依赖库:npm install clipboard -- save。接着,在需要使用复制功能的组件中引入clipboard.js,引入方式为:import Clipboard from clipboard。
定义一个数据属性来保存从后端获取的数据,在Vue组件的mounted生命周期钩子函数中,使用合适的方式(如Axios、FetchAPI等)向后端发送请求,并将返回的数据存储到backendData属性中。在VueelInput组件的value属性中绑定backendData属性,以便将后端数据显示在输入框中。
vue如何获取input的值
获取Vue输入值,关键在于利用v-model指令,这是一种双向绑定方式。以下步骤以简明方式展示如何实现这一功能。首先,在页面中引入Vue框架。接着,定义Vue应用的基本结构,包含数据和行为。在定义中,加入一个输入框元素,用于用户输入信息,同时定义一个变量来存储这个输入框的值。
实现点击按钮复制input输入框内容,可以借助clipboard.js库。首先,通过npm安装此依赖库:npm install clipboard -- save。接着,在需要使用复制功能的组件中引入clipboard.js,引入方式为:import Clipboard from clipboard。
定义一个数据属性来保存从后端获取的数据,在Vue组件的mounted生命周期钩子函数中,使用合适的方式(如Axios、FetchAPI等)向后端发送请求,并将返回的数据存储到backendData属性中。在VueelInput组件的value属性中绑定backendData属性,以便将后端数据显示在输入框中。
首先之一步,这时候我们使用vue-cli脚手架工具创建一个vue项目,注意都是然后引入element-ui框架(不会的详情参考下面经验),详细目录文件如下图。
在Vue中实现输入框Input输入限制,可以通过以下几种 *** :利用Vue的修饰符:.number修饰符:可以通过在vmodel后添加.number来实现数字输入限制。但请注意,这种 *** 仅适用于简单的数字输入,存在局限性。监听@input :通过监听@input ,可以实时获取输入框的内容并进行处理,以实现更复杂的输入限制。
vue3在@input 上手动改变input的值,但是视图上的值改了
在Vue3中,当您尝试在@input 上手动改变input的值,而视图上的值也随之改变时,您可能陷入了误区。这是因为字符串是值传递的特性,您修改 实例的值,并不会影响原始值。假若您有一个名为seperator的函数,该函数在多个地方被调用,意味着该函数实际上构成了input的一部分。
利用Vue的修饰符:.number修饰符:可以通过在vmodel后添加.number来实现数字输入限制。但请注意,这种 *** 仅适用于简单的数字输入,存在局限性。监听@input :通过监听@input ,可以实时获取输入框的内容并进行处理,以实现更复杂的输入限制。
在你提到的特定场景中,似乎你关注的是更新数据时视图不刷新的问题。但通常,Vue的 @input 与v-for结合使用时,应能有效处理这类情况。当你绑定 @input 处理程序时,Vue会立即响应输入 并更新状态。这意味着,只要你的状态更新与UI更新相关联,视图就应该能够同步更新。
在Vue 3中,通常使用v-model指令绑定表单元素和组件值,这样能自动触发change 。然而,若需手动触发change ,可通过以下步骤实现。在自定义组件里,使用$emit *** 手动触发 。当输入框值变化时,@change 被触发,并通过$emit向父组件传入当前输入框值。
问题:input数据改变后页面没有实时更新。解决方案:调整showLoading与showToast的时机,使用setTimeout延迟toast的执行。状态管理和持久化:推荐方案:使用pinia作为全局状态管理工具,相较于vuex体验更优。对于持久化需求,可通过uni.setStorageSync实现,若需求量大,则引入piniapluginunistorage插件。
在Vue应用中,你可能会遇到在输入框上设置oninput 并使用正则表达式限制输入为整数的情况。然而,当尝试使用v-model绑定数据时,你可能会发现输入框的值并未按照预期更新。这种现象通常发生在用户使用快捷键如Ctrl+C复制粘贴带有小数点的数字时。
el-input默认设置在哪
1、el-input的默认设置通常是在使用组件时通过属性绑定来配置的,而不是在全局或某个固定位置统一设置。以下是关于el-input默认设置的相关信息: 默认值的设置:- 通过v-model绑定:在Vue组件中,你可以通过v-model指令将el-input组件与某个数据属性绑定。当这个数据属性有初始值时,el-input就会显示这个初始值作为默认值。
2、打开HBuilderX开发工具,使用npm安装和 vue项目,并安装依赖包。在项目中的src文件夹下的components中,新建一个组件Input.vue。打开已新建的组件文件,在template标签中插入el-input组件,并绑定v-model指令。接着在script、/script标签中,导出export default,初始化startData和endData。
3、点击文件右击选择“属性”;在“常规”选项卡中查看是否被勾选的“只读”选项,如果是,取消即可。打开word文档,直接点击“审阅”中的“限制编辑”,选择“停止保护”,输入密码即可编辑。本教程操作环境:windows7系统,Microsoft Office word2010版本,Dell G3电脑。
vue切换input的type类型,为什么输入框中的内容也会被清空
1、这是因为Vue在进行DOM渲染时,出于性能考虑。会尽可能的复用已经存在的元素,而不是在新创建新的元素。在上面的案例中, Vue内部会发现原来的input元素不再使用,直接作为else中的input来使用了。
2、在Vue中实现输入框Input输入限制,可以通过以下几种 *** :利用Vue的修饰符:.number修饰符:可以通过在vmodel后添加.number来实现数字输入限制。但请注意,这种 *** 仅适用于简单的数字输入,存在局限性。监听@input :通过监听@input ,可以实时获取输入框的内容并进行处理,以实现更复杂的输入限制。
3、查询资料此问题出现的原因是:vue页面进行数据渲染时,层次嵌套或者多重数据绑定导致该组件信息框数据不能被Vue实时监听到,以此出现了数据发生改变但页面上更新或删除对应信息框的数据毫无反应的现象,此时需要强制更新,重新渲染。
vue清空inputfile的值的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于vue $ref内容清空、vue清空inputfile的值的信息别忘了在本站进行查找喔。
![前端开发技术大全 | 最新教程、实战项目、资源下载 - [米特尔科技]](http://jlmte.com/zb_users/theme/quietlee/style/images/logo.png)
![前端开发技术大全 | 最新教程、实战项目、资源下载 - [米特尔科技]](http://jlmte.com/zb_users/theme/quietlee/style/images/yjlogo.png)


